What is a 24V Lithium Ion Battery?
A 24V lithium ion battery is a rechargeable energy storage solution composed of lithium-ion cells connected in series to produce a nominal voltage of 24 volts. This configuration is especially popular due to its balance between power capacity and compact size. Lithium-ion batteries are favored for their high energy density, lightweight nature, and longevity compared to traditional lead-acid batteries.
Benefits of 24V Lithium Ion Batteries
Lithium-ion batteries have a higher energy density than their lead-acid counterparts. This means they can store more energy in the same amount of space, making them ideal for applications where space is limited.
Typically, a 24V lithium ion battery can endure more charge and discharge cycles, reaching between 2,000 to 5,000 cycles, depending on the quality of the battery and usage conditions. This extended lifespan translates to cost savings in the long run.
One of the standout features of lithium-ion technology is the rapid charging capability. A well-designed 24V lithium ion battery can be charged to 80% in just an hour, which is considerably faster compared to lead-acid batteries.
Lithium-ion batteries are much lighter and more compact, which makes them easier to handle and transport. This characteristic is particularly important for electric vehicles and portable devices.
Compared to other battery technologies, lithium-ion batteries experience a low self-discharge rate. This means they can retain their charge longer when not in use, making them ideal for applications where intermittent use is common.
Key Specifications to Consider
When selecting a 24V lithium ion battery, several specifications should guide your choice:
Measured in amp-hours (Ah), the capacity of a battery indicates how much energy it can store. For example, a 100Ah battery can provide a current of 100 amps for one hour. Choose a capacity that meets your power needs without overloading your system.
This indicates how quickly a battery can deliver energy. If you need a battery for high-power applications, look for one with a higher discharge rate.
As mentioned, lithium-ion batteries have a long cycle life. However, check the manufacturer’s specifications for expected cycle life to understand how long the battery will last under typical use patterns.
Different batteries have different charging times. If quick recharging is essential for your application, you may want to opt for a battery that can charge rapidly.
Lithium-ion battery performance can be greatly affected by temperature. Ensure the battery you select can operate effectively in the climate conditions you’ll expose it to.
Applications of 24V Lithium Ion Batteries
From e-bikes to scooters, 24V lithium ion batteries are commonly used as the power source for electric vehicles where weight and size are critical factors.
Many homeowners use 24V lithium ion batteries in solar panel systems to store energy for night use. Their efficiency and lifespan make them a suitable choice for renewable energy solutions.
Lightweight and long-lasting, these batteries provide the necessary energy for cordless power tools, making them convenient for both professional and DIY users.
For recreational vehicles and boats, 24V lithium-ion batteries can supply power to various appliances and systems, offering a reliable and lightweight solution compared to traditional lead-acid batteries.
